Maranery
Maranery is a village in Budalur, Thanjavur, Tamil Nadu and has about 1,250 residents. Maranery is situated nearby to the village Kadambankudi, as well as near the hamlet Valayakudi.Places in the Area

Budalur is a Town and Taluk in Thanjavur district of Tamil Nadu. There is a famous historic Shiva temple known as the Abathsagayeshwarar Temple situated in Budalur, built by Great Emperor Raja Raja Cholan during 10th century. Budalur is situated 8 km east of Maranery.
